Good for those wanting a slow-paced nature and small-town vibe, not for those seeking city hustle or crowded attractions. Best time to visit is July, when the weather is warmest for outdoor activities. Budget around CAD 500-800. City transport is convenient, with cross-area travel taking no more than 30 minutes. Must-visit: Huron River Trail and Cranberry Festival (summer). Skip the local museum—content is limited. Avoid renting cars during peak seasons, as they’re expensive and parking is hard to find.
